    Their on-again, off-again relationship has been in the news all over the world, and now Jennifer Lopez and Ben Affleck are finally breaking up.

    The singer and actor filed for divorce on August 20, which was their second wedding anniversary. This was the second time that she and Bennifer were no longer together.
    They started dating while they were both working on the love comedy Gigli in 2003. They got engaged almost twenty years ago, but the next year they chose to put off their wedding because of all the attention from the media.

    They got back together after breaking up in 2004 and had a surprise wedding in Las Vegas in 2022. After a month, they had a party for family and friends at a Georgia house that Affleck had bought when they first started dating 20 years ago.

    Affleck asked Lopez to marry him a second time when they got back together. Lopez said, “I feel so lucky, happy, and proud to be with him.” We got a second chance, which is a beautiful love story.

    Lopez released a documentary in 2024 called The Greatest Love Story Never Told. It told the story of her self-produced record This Is Me… Now and her long-term search for self-love. Affleck was the main reason she decided to go through with the idea.

    “I told myself, ‘I don’t write, I don’t do this.'” She remembered that he told her, “You do, you write, you direct, you produce, you choreograph, you do everything.” “You need to take a step into that and own some of who you are.”

    In the documentary, Affleck said he didn’t like how Lopez wanted their relationship to be the center of attention, but he had learned to “compromise.”

    There were reports that they were splitting up in May 2022, after they hadn’t been seen together in almost two months. At the time, neither Lopez nor Affleck said anything about the rumors that their relationship was “broken.” In May, a reporter asked the Jenny from the Block singer about the reports at a press conference in Mexico for her Netflix movie Atlas. She said, “You know better than that.”

    He missed her birthday party and was said to have moved his stuff out of the house they shared, which made it clear that things had gone badly in their relationship.
    We now know that Lopez and Affleck are no longer together. On Tuesday, Lopez’s ex-boyfriend, former MLB player Alex Rodriguez, posted a mysterious quote to Instagram Stories, which made many people wonder if it was meant to insult Lopez.

    “You should choose which way to go, because you’re only going to go one way,” he wrote.

    People said that a person said Rodriquez’s post was just a coincidence and “has nothing to do” with Lopez.

    Rodriguez and Lopez were together for four years.
    “We’ve come to the conclusion that we’re better off as friends and aim to stay that way.” In a joint statement at the time, they said, “We will continue to work together and help each other with our shared businesses and projects.” “May the best things happen to each other and our children.” For their sake, the only other thing we can say is “thank you” to everyone who has sent support and kind words.

    Being close to Affleck was seen with the singer soon after her breakup with Rodriguez.
